Are topical flea and tapeworm treatments safe for pregnant dogs?

Updated On September 23rd, 2025

I have two female dogs who are pregnant and that have fleas. My cat has a tapeworm as well. I wanted to know if topical flea treatments are safe for pregnant bitches and are there any tapeworm preventatives that are safe for them as well.

Frontline and Revolution are safe for use in pregnant dogs. If you're already using a heartworm preventative with ivermectin, please continue to do so as it is safe for both the mom and pups and will help prevent her from passing parasites to the pups. And if they is due for vaccinations, getting them while she is pregnant will boost her and the pups immunity to disease. For tapeworms, Drontal is safe to use during all life stages, including pregnancy.
